15 Cheap Gaming Room Upgrades That Look Insanely Expensive

 

Creating an amazing gaming room doesn’t always require a massive budget. In fact, some of the best-looking setups online use simple upgrades that are surprisingly affordable.

The secret is knowing which changes create the biggest visual impact without draining your wallet.

If you want your setup to feel cleaner, more immersive, and more premium, these budget-friendly gaming room upgrades can completely transform your space.


1. LED Light Strips

Nothing changes the atmosphere of a gaming room faster than lighting.

LED strips instantly make a setup feel:

  • modern

  • immersive

  • cinematic

Best Places to Install Them

  • behind monitors

  • under desks

  • behind shelves

  • around the bed frame

Soft indirect lighting always looks more expensive than harsh overhead lights.


2. Cable Management Kits

Messy cables can ruin even the most expensive gaming setup.

A few cheap cable organizers can instantly make your room look cleaner and more professional.

Common Mistakes That Make Setups Look Cheap

Too Much RGB

Overusing bright colors can make the room feel chaotic.


Poor Cable Management

Visible cable mess ruins immersion instantly.


Overcrowded Decorations

Too many figures or accessories make small rooms feel cluttered.


Mismatched Colors

Try to stick to one consistent aesthetic.
